Can the Lib Dems build on their by-election successes?

To their many enemies, the Liberal Democrats are the Japanese knotweed of British politics - once established, very, very difficult to get rid of. Like the invasive weed, you can think you've extirpated it entirely and there's no sign of it for years and then, one day, you notice a little orange shoot poking up through the apparently impenetrable tarmac you've laid. The Tiverton and Honiton by-election win is just such a remarkable sprouting, punching through the solid weight of a Conservative majority of 24,200 votes.

Corbyn to fight blogger's libel claim in High Court

Former Labour leader Jeremy Corbyn is due to give evidence at a three-week High Court trial after being accused of libel by a political blogger, a judge has been told. Richard Millett has sued Mr Corbyn over remarks he made during an interview on the BBC's The Andrew Marr Show in 2018, when he was leader of the opposition.
